FAQs About User Experience Testing

1. What is user experience (UX) testing?

User experience (UX) testing assesses how real users interact with a product or service through observation and feedback collection methods like interviews or surveys.

2. Why is UX testing crucial for my business?

It's vital because it helps identify usability issues early on which can save time & money while ensuring you're meeting customer needs effectively!

3. How often should I conduct UX tests?

Regularly conducting tests throughout different stages—like pre-launch & post-launch phases—ensures ongoing optimization based upon changing trends/feedback loops!

4. What methods are used for UX testing?

Common methods include usability studies (observing interaction), A/B split tests (comparing two versions), surveys/interviews (gathering direct feedback).
